对于不会编程的人,可以采取以下几种策略来提高他们的编程能力:
培养兴趣和动力
找到编程的乐趣和意义,比如通过实际项目应用或解决具体问题来激发兴趣。
设定明确的学习目标和奖励机制,增强学习的动力。
建立基础知识和技能
学习编程的基本概念,如变量、循环、条件语句等。
掌握至少一种编程语言的基础语法,可以通过在线课程、教程或书籍来学习。
克服恐惧和挫败感
接受失败是学习过程的一部分,从错误中学习并不断尝试。
寻求帮助和支持,加入编程社区或寻找学习伙伴,共同解决问题。
合理安排时间和资源
制定学习计划,合理安排时间,保持学习的连续性和稳定性。
利用免费或低成本的学习资源,如在线教程、开源项目、编程挑战等。
培养专注力和耐心
设定专门的学习环境,减少干扰,提高学习效率。
坚持长期学习,不要期望一蹴而就,保持耐心和毅力。
建立良好的学习习惯
制定学习大纲,明确学习目标和进度。
结合书本、视频和实际项目等多种学习资源,形成系统的学习方法。
动手实践
多写代码,通过实际操作来巩固理论知识。
参与开源项目或自己发起小项目,提升编程实战能力。
培养逻辑思维能力
通过数学练习、逻辑游戏等方式提高逻辑思维能力。
在编程中不断锻炼分析问题和解决问题的能力。
寻求反馈和指导
定期回顾和评估自己的学习成果,找出不足并进行改进。
寻求专业人士或同伴的反馈,及时调整学习策略。
通过以上策略,即使是没有编程基础的人也可以逐步掌握编程技能。重要的是保持积极的学习态度,不断实践和探索,最终实现编程能力的提升。